2005
MDSA founded by Carolyn Scott, Ann Priddy, Karen Johnson, Pam Martin, and Brigitte Sclabas.
2006
First MDSA Video Film Festival (non-titling).
2007
Second MDSA Video Film Festival (non-titling).
2008
First MDSA Video Titling Event
First MDSA Live Titling Event hosted by the Capering Canines of Cape Cod in Cape Cod, MA USA
First Freestyle Dog title earned by MP Jackson & Golden Retriever Stella in the Novice class
2010
64 teams matched in the March "Magic of the Match" workshop.
2011
A third yearly video event is added.
2012
Titling classes expanded to include Intermediate, Team, Pairs, Props, and Spirit of Sharing.
2025
MDSA made new changes to the website and Performance Guidelines to make it easier to compete at MDSA video events.
Performance Guidelines can now be read online as well as downloaded.
The Snapshot section is formatted to display class comparisons. As well as Snapshot with associated fee structure.MDSA requests videos be uploaded to YouTube as Public or Unlisted and will request permission to share your videos on FB and MDSA playlists.
You can now enter two videos in the same event if they are in the same class! They can be the same routine, but need to be different performances/videos. This makes it possible to earn titles quicker!
Two (2) qualifying legs are required to earn a title.
Performances for each qualifying leg in Video Events may be the same routine and music as long as it is a different video of a different performance.
Performances for each qualifying leg must be earned with the same handler and dog team, including the Team classes.
Only two (2) titling class solo entries per dog (Novice, Intermediate, Standard, Premier, Veteran, Props) per event are allowed. You may additionally enter at any one event for any other class such as Team, Brace, Pair.
You may not complete more than one title in the same class in the same event.
Entrants may rework and enter the same routine or the same music to earn a qualifying leg at a later event.
The Learning Center on the MDSA website is now available for everyone, not just members!
Treats are optional and may be used at all levels except the Premier level.
Rookie and Rookie Prop are now titling and are open to all teams!
